#ff2eb5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ff2eb5 is composed of 100% red, 18%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82% magenta, 29%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 321.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 59%. #ff2eb5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5cff with #ff006b.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#ff2eb5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ff2eb5 has RGB values of R:255, G:46,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.29, K:0. Its decimal value is 16723637.

Shades and Tints of #ff2eb5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070004 is the darkest color, while #fff2f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ff2eb5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f8e99 is the less saturated color, while #ff2eb5 is the most saturated one.
